Bit Torrent
So I have stayed away from Torrents, but I found out Top Gear is out there.
I downloaded the Bit Torrent client, and it is slow as a dog. I have used other p2p clients, and nothing this slow. I am getting 44 seeds and 6 peers and only 1.4k down. FYI - RR Cable Modem 5mb down/384 up. Am I missing something? .ps I had read that some ISPs are "throttling" certain protocols. Would that be a part of the problem?

I use Azureus also. Older version is better on OSX, don't know about XP.
You should always seed, the more you contribute the more you will be rewarded with bandwidth. If you are on XP then open the max TCP connections. XP defaults to 10 TCP connections which will limit the number of peers that you can connect to. Try 50 connections, more is not always better and a lot of seeds don't have that many peers anyway so only open as far as makes sense.

Sometimes you just get unlucky too. I've had a single torrent go from like 3k to over 128k and back over a period of hours. If the peers are limiting their bandwidth way down, it can be a problem. Also some peer software limit downloads to the available upload speed.
